信息处理系统和信息处理方法技术方案

技术编号:9671678 阅读:65 留言:0更新日期:2014-02-14 19:08
本发明专利技术提供一种信息处理系统和信息处理方法。信息处理系统包括算术处理单元、包含主存储器的主控制单元以及各自包括从存储器的从控制单元。主控制单元将从算术处理单元发送的、包括可以指定主存储器和从存储器中的任意一个的地址的地址信息的发送数据存储在主存储器中,或者经由通信数据存储器向相应的从存储器发送该发送数据。该信息处理系统可以减少从主控制单元到从控制单元的指示次数。

【技术实现步骤摘要】

本专利技术涉及一种信息处理系统,其包括算术处理单元、用于根据来自算术处理单元的指令执行处理的主控制单元以及用于根据来自算术处理单元的指令对负载进行控制的从控制单元。
技术介绍
使用电子摄影的图像形成设备包括进行图像形成所需的多个功能,例如用于输送诸如薄片的记录材料的输送功能、用于生成图像的图像形成功能以及用于将图像定影在记录材料上的定影功能。当由单个中央处理器(CPU)实现这些功能时,CPU的处理负荷增加,由此使得总体处理缓慢。另外,从CPU至连接了诸如电机的致动器的板的配线的布置变得复杂。因此,希望使用实现执行功能的多个控制模块对图像形成设备的操作执行分布式控制。每个控制模块包括执行用于实现相关联的功能的处理的CPU。对于CPU和多个控制模块之间的数据的发送和接收,有时使用串行通信。随着由各个CPU控制的诸如电机的负载的数量增加,使用串行通信的控制指令的频率增加。因此,除了通过串行通信的发送指令所使用的存储器之外,控制指令所使用的用于各个控制模块的地址和数据的存储器增加,这导致成本增加。此外,CPU需要等待下一次发送直到串行通信完成为止,这导致吞吐量降低。日本特开昭63-224545提出了在用于通过串行通信的发送的存储器没有空间时,通过请求发送端暂停发送,来有效地使用存储器的技术。在使用在日本特开昭63-224545中公开的串行通信的数据通信技术中,随着发送的数据量增加,通信更频繁地停止。因此,当将在日本特开昭63-224545中公开的技术应用于图像形成设备时,存在例如由于对用于输送记录材料的电机的控制的延迟而出现卡纸等问题。作为针对上述问题的对策而增加存储器的容量导致成本增加,这对于商品不是优选的。
技术实现思路
为了解决上述问题,根据本专利技术的示例性实施例,提供一种信息处理系统,包括:算术处理单元;主控制单元,用于根据来自所述算术处理单元的指令而执行处理;从控制单元,其包括从存储器,并且用于根据来自所述算术处理单元的指令而对负载进行控制;第一通信线路,用于将所述算术处理单元连接到所述主控制单元;以及第二通信线路,用于将所述主控制单元连接到所述从控制单元,其中,所述主控制单元包括地址解码器、主存储器和通信数据存储器;所述算术处理单元经由所述第一通信线路,向所述主控制单元发送写入命令、系统地址空间中的地址信息、以及数据;所述系统地址空间中的地址信息是用于指定所述系统地址空间中的地址的信息,所述系统地址空间是通过整合所述主存储器的主存储器地址空间和所述从存储器的从存储器地址空间而获得的空间;包括在所述主控制单元中的所述地址解码器用于对从所述算术处理单元接收到的所述系统地址空间中的地址信息进行分析,并且选择从所述算术处理单元接收到的数据的写入目的地;所述主控制单元在所述地址解码器选择所述主存储器作为所述写入目的地的情况下,将从所述算术处理单元接收到的数据写入所述主存储器的所述主存储器地址空间的与所述系统地址空间中的地址信息相对应的地址,并且基于写入所述主存储器的数据而执行处理;以及所述主控制单元在所述地址解码器选择所述从存储器作为所述写入目的地的情况下,基于所述系统地址空间中的地址信息,生成所述从存储器地址空间中的地址信息,将所述写入命令、所述从存储器地址空间中的地址信息、以及所述数据写入所述通信数据存储器,并且经由所述第二通信线路向所述从控制单元发送被写入所述通信数据存储器的所述写入命令、所述从存储器地址空间中的地址信息、以及所述数据。根据本专利技术的示例性实施例,还提供一种由系统执行的信息处理方法,所述系统包括:算术处理单元;主控制单元,其包括地址解码器、主存储器和通信数据存储器,并且用于根据来自所述算术处理单元的指令而执行处理;从控制单元,其包括从存储器,并且用于根据来自所述算术处理单元的指令而对负载进行控制;第一通信线路,用于将所述算术处理单元连接到所述主控制单元;以及第二通信线路,用于将所述主控制单元连接到所述从控制单元,其中,所述系统被配置为形成系统地址空间,所述系统地址空间是通过整合所述主存储器的主存储器地址空间和所述从存储器的从存储器地址空间而获得的空间,所述信息处理方法包括:所述算术处理单元经由所述第一通信线路,向所述主控制单元发送写入命令、所述系统地址空间中的地址信息、以及数据,其中,所述系统地址空间中的地址信息是用于指定所述系统地址空间中的地址的信息;所述主控制单元的所述地址解码器对从所述算术处理单元接收到的所述系统地址空间中的地址信息进行分析,并且选择从所述算术处理单元接收到的数据的写入目的地;在所述地址解码器选择所述主存储器作为所述写入目的地的情况下,所述主控制单元将从所述算术处理单元接收到的数据写入所述主存储器的所述主存储器地址空间的与所述系统地址空间中的地址信息相对应的地址,并且基于写入所述主存储器的数据而执行处理;在所述地址解码器选择所述从存储器作为所述写入目的地的情况下,所述主控制单元基于所述系统地址空间中的地址信息,生成所述从存储器地址空间中的地址信息,并且将所述写入命令、所述从存储器地址空间中的地址信息、以及所述数据写入所述通信数据存储器;以及所述主控制单元经由所述第二通信线路向所述从控制单元发送被写入所述通信数据存储器的所述写入命令、所述从存储器地址空间中的地址信息、以及所述数据。根据本专利技术的示例性实施例,还提供一种计算机可读存储器介质,其上存储有能够使计算机执行根据上述的信息处理方法的程序。从以下对示例性实施例的描述(参考附图),本专利技术的其它特征将变得明显。【附图说明】图1是根据本专利技术的实施例的图像形成设备的示意图。图2是图像形成单元的详细配置视图。图3是控制模块的示例性配置图。图4是输送模块B的示例性详细配置图。图5A是根据本实施例的系统地址空间的说明图。图5B是传统系统地址空间的说明图。图6是示出通信处理的处理过程的流程图。图7A是并行总线的时序图。图7B是内部总线的时序图。图7C是串行总线的时序图。【具体实施方式】下面,参考附图详细描述实施例。图1是应用根据本实施例的串行通信设备的图像形成设备1000的示意性立体图。图像形成设备1000包括自动原稿给送器(ADF) 100、图像扫描器200、图像形成单元300和操作单元10。图像扫描器200设置在图像形成单元300上。ADF100安装在图像扫描器200上。由多个控制单元以分布的方式控制图像形成设备1000的这些部件。可以使用CPU、专用半导体器件等用于每个控制单元。ADF100将原稿自动输送到原稿玻璃上。图像扫描器200对从ADF100输送的原稿进行扫描,并且输出图像数据。图像形成单元300基于从图像扫描器200输出的图像数据或者通过网络从外部装置输入的图像数据,在诸如纸的记录材料上形成图像。操作单元10具有使得用户能够进行各种操作的图形用户接口(GUI)。操作单元10具有例如配备有触摸面板的显示器,以使得能够向用户显示信息。图像形成单元图2是图像形成单元300的详细配置视图。图像形成单元300采用电子摄影。在图2中,附图标记末尾的字母Y、M、C和K分别表示黄色、品红色、青色和黑色。在下面的描述中,在描述中引用所有颜色的情况下,省略附图标记末尾的字母Y、M、C和K。感光鼓(下文中称为“感光构件本文档来自技高网
...

【技术保护点】
一种信息处理系统,包括:算术处理单元;主控制单元,用于根据来自所述算术处理单元的指令而执行处理;从控制单元,其包括从存储器,并且用于根据来自所述算术处理单元的指令而对负载进行控制;第一通信线路,用于将所述算术处理单元连接到所述主控制单元;以及第二通信线路,用于将所述主控制单元连接到所述从控制单元,其中,所述主控制单元包括地址解码器、主存储器和通信数据存储器;所述算术处理单元经由所述第一通信线路,向所述主控制单元发送写入命令、系统地址空间中的地址信息、以及数据;所述系统地址空间中的地址信息是用于指定所述系统地址空间中的地址的信息,所述系统地址空间是通过整合所述主存储器的主存储器地址空间和所述从存储器的从存储器地址空间而获得的空间;包括在所述主控制单元中的所述地址解码器用于对从所述算术处理单元接收到的所述系统地址空间中的地址信息进行分析,并且选择从所述算术处理单元接收到的数据的写入目的地;所述主控制单元在所述地址解码器选择所述主存储器作为所述写入目的地的情况下,将从所述算术处理单元接收到的数据写入所述主存储器的所述主存储器地址空间的与所述系统地址空间中的地址信息相对应的地址,并且基于写入所述主存储器的数据而执行处理;以及所述主控制单元在所述地址解码器选择所述从存储器作为所述写入目的地的情况下,基于所述系统地址空间中的地址信息,生成所述从存储器地址空间中的地址信息,将所述写入命令、所述从存储器地址空间中的地址信息、以及所述数据写入所述通信数据存储器,并且经由所述第二通信线路向所述从控制单元发送被写入所述通信数据存储器的所述写入命令、所述从存 储器地址空间中的地址信息、以及所述数据。...

【技术特征摘要】
2012.07.23 JP 2012-1628331.一种信息处理系统,包括: 算术处理单元; 主控制单元,用于根据来自所述算术处理单元的指令而执行处理; 从控制单元,其包括从存储器,并且用于根据来自所述算术处理单元的指令而对负载进行控制; 第一通信线路,用于将所述算术处理单元连接到所述主控制单元;以及 第二通信线路,用于将所述主控制单元连接到所述从控制单元, 其中,所述主控制单元包括地址解码器、主存储器和通信数据存储器; 所述算术处理单元经由所述第一通信线路,向所述主控制单元发送写入命令、系统地址空间中的地址信息、以及数据; 所述系统地址空间中的地址信息是用于指定所述系统地址空间中的地址的信息,所述系统地址空间是通过整合所述主存储器的主存储器地址空间和所述从存储器的从存储器地址空间而获得的空间; 包括在所述主控制单元中的所述地址解码器用于对从所述算术处理单元接收到的所述系统地址空间中的地址信息进行分析,并且选择从所述算术处理单元接收到的数据的写入目的地; 所述主控制单元在所述地址解码器选择所述主存储器作为所述写入目的地的情况下,将从所述算术处理单元接收到的数据写入所述主存储器的所述主存储器地址空间的与所述系统地址空间中的地址信息相对应的地址,并且基于写入所述主存储器的数据而执行处理;以及 所述主控制单元在所述地址解码器选择所述从存储器作为所述写入目的地的情况下,基于所述系统地址空间中的地址信息,生成所述从存储器地址空间中的地址信息,将所述写入命令、所述从存储器地址空间中的地址信息、以及所述数据写入所述通信数据存储器,并且经由所述第二通信线路向所述从控制单元发送被写入所述通信数据存储器的所述写入命令、所述从存储器地址空间中的地址信息、以及所述数据。2.根据权利要求1所述的信息处理系统,其中, 所述从控制单元将从所述主控制单元接收到的数据,写入与从所述主控制单元接收到的所述从存储器地址空间中的地址信息相对应的所述从存储器的地址,并且基于写入所述从存储器的数据而对所述负载进行控制。3.根据权利要求1所述的信息处理系统,其中, 所述地址解码器基于所述系统地址空间中的地址信息的预定地址的数据,选择从所述算术处理单元接收到的数据的写入目的地;以及 所述地址解码器通过从所述系统地址空间中的地址信息提取所述预定地址,来生成所述从存储器地址空间中的地址信息。4.根据权利要求1所述的信息处理系统,其中, 所述第一通信线路包括并行总线;以及 所述第二通信线路包括串行总线。5.一种由系统执行的信息处理方法,所述系统包括: 算术处理单元;主控制单元,其包括地址解码器、主存...

【专利技术属性】
技术研发人员:关广高
申请(专利权)人:佳能株式会社
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1